Thick and Chewy Peanut Butter Cookies

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 12 minutes
  • Total Time: 27 minutes
  • Yield: 24 cookies

Description

These thick and chewy peanut butter cookies are soft, rich, and packed with peanut butter flavor! Perfect for dessert or a sweet snack.


Ingredients

  • 1 cup creamy peanut butter

  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ened

  • 1 cup brown sugar, packed

  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ar

  • 2 large eggs

  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our

  • 1 teaspoon baking soda

  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der

  • 1/4 teaspoon salt


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

  2. Cream Butter and Sugars: In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ened butter, peanut but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until light and fluffy (about 2–3 minutes).

  3. Add Eggs and Vanilla: Beat in the eggs, one at a time, ensuring each is fully incorporated. Stir in the vanilla extract until smooth.

  4.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.

  5.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ients: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the wet mixture until a soft dough forms. Be careful not to overmix.

  6. Shape and Flatten the Dough: Scoop out about 2 tablespoons of dough per cookie and roll into balls. Place them 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heet. Use a fork to press down lightly, creating a crisscross pattern on each cookie.

  7. Bake the Cookies: Bake for 10–12 minutes, or until the edges are golden but the centers remain soft.

  8. Cool and Serve: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ely. Enjoy warm or at room temperature!


Notes

  • For extra peanut butter flavor, use crunchy peanut butter instead of creamy.

  • Store cookies in an airtight container for up to 5 days.

  • To freeze dough, roll into balls and freeze on a baking sheet. Once frozen, transfer to a zip-top bag and bake as needed.
